[Question] How do I download images from the camera to a Windows computer using the supplied DL-10 software?

The [DL-10] software allows you to download pictures all at once in a camera automatically when you connect a camera to a computer. In order to use the DL-10 will automatically craeate [Digital Camera] folder in [My Documents] folder. With the default settings, the downloaded pictures are saved into a new folder assigning the captured date, which is located in the [Digital Camera] folder. (If you were previously using Caplio Software, the files will continue to be saved in the [Caplio] folder.) Set the correct date and time on the camera before shooting.

As an example, the procedures for downloading images from your camera to a Windows XP computer using DL-10 are shown below.

The supported operating systems are as follows.
Windows Vista, Windows XP, Windows 2000, Windows Me

Disconnect the USB cable.

  • If the USB cable is disconnected without disabling the connection, the Unsafe Removal of Device screen may be displayed. Be sure to stop the connection before removing the USB cable.
  • Do not disconnect the USB cable during image downloading. Make sure that downloading has completed, disable the connection, and then disconnect the cable.
  • When images are transferred to a computer, they are saved under new file names. File names in the camera are not used.
  • The images are saved under consecutively numbered file names in order to avoid duplication of file names.
  • Even if the images are saved in different folders, their file names are still consecutively numbered. You cannot initialize the numbers.
  • If you transfer images to a computer using DL-10, their file names are still saved as [RIMG****.jpg] (where **** is a number), even if [Card Sequence No.] is set to [On].
